Parma to Ironton is 248.4 miles and takes about 5h via I 71 and US 23, with a fuel budget near $39 and enough daylight to finish in a day. This drive stays within Ohio, moving from the Midwest region to another part of the Midwest. Expect a mostly highway experience for the majority of this trip. With a single recommended day and a relatively short duration, this route is well-suited for a straightforward, single-day excursion.

This trip is primarily a highway drive, with 70% of it on high-speed roads. You'll encounter the longest continuous stretch of driving on I 71 for 118.3 miles. The route transitions from highway to surface roads, indicated by the change in road types. Be prepared for a noticeable increase in exit density as you approach more populated areas.
This is a straightforward highway drive that stays mostly on I 71 and Portsmouth - Columbus Road. This route has several spots where lane changes, forks, or exits need your full attention. The trickiest moment comes around 0.6 miles in near SR 3 / Ridge Road.
